Look below scenario: (1) The first time we push packet through a transport, dst_cookie is = 0, so sctp_transport_dst_check also pass cookie as 0, then return ds= t as NULL. Then we lookup dst by sctp_transport_route, and in there we initi= ate dst_cookie with rt->rt6i_node->fn_sernum (2) Then the next time we push packet through this transport again, we pass dst_cookie(rt->rt6i_node->fn_sernum) to ip6_dst_check, an= d return valid dst without bothering to lookup dst again. BUT, suppose when deleting the source address of this dst after transpo= rt->dst_cookie has been well initialized. transport->dst_cookie still holds rt->rt6i_n= ode->fn_sernum, meaning ip6_dst_check will return valid dst, which it shouldn't in this= case, the result will be association ABORT.
